why so many redrums? i get so much out of just one
chillifucker12 2 years ago
Each redrum only allows you to add up to 10 samples so I've separated each redrum between Kick & Snares, Hi Hats, and Crashes & Builds. This way I'm able to add more complexity to different sections of the song.

how did you make the club bass???
21centimetres 3 years ago
Its a sawtooth wave sound in the Subtractor and I added a reverb and a two band parameter with the wave put all the way up and widened. At around 00:25 you can see the setup. Then its up to you to make the melody and effect changes.
